Output d6982b64d76c1a20e35c9171751085d078738b5484e6fae7e1a252cdfae67971:0

value
27372598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94d03ec0114efe9686ae8e92e0aa5ced492d1d3a OP_EQUAL
address
3FFsQ4PAk1SHPL8x67qkK83aPhXN1DoSnz
transaction
d6982b64d76c1a20e35c9171751085d078738b5484e6fae7e1a252cdfae67971
confirmations
285454
spent
true